Zipcar comes to downtown East Lansing

September 19, 2014

Located in Parking Lot 4 on the corner of Albert Avenue and Abbot Road, Zipcar now offer residents and students two Ford Focuses for daily use.

Zipcar University General Manager Katelyn Lopresti expressed her excitement about the new partnership between the city of East Lansing and Zipcar.

“We’re excited to bring the members of East Lansing a car sharing option that they already readily embrace,” Lopresti said.

Having Zipcar in downtown East Lansing will bring benefits to the community, Lopresti said.

“Community members recognize the benefits Zipcar brings to their community, including reduction of traffic congestion, lowering of carbon emissions,” Lopresti said. “As well as the convenient and cost-effective transportation solution it creates.”

East Lansing mayor Nathan Triplett said Parking Lot 4 was chosen because of its accessible location.

“I think it was the right combination of being easily accessible, highly visible and a place that everyone is familiar with,” Triplett said.

There are already six Zipcars scattered around campus — Lots 32, 41, 50 and 73.

Through an online subscription, Zipcar users will create a membership that will let them rent the different cars on the United States of America and the United Kingdom.

The city will later consider expanding the amount of Zipcars in downtown depending on the usage of the cars by residents.

“For now we will start with two (vehicles) and then, depending on how the community respond to it . . . we can think about expanding,” Triplett said.

Students 18 years or older can rent the cars for rates as low as $7.50 an hour, according to an announcement released by the Communications Department of East Lansing.

“There is no rate change based on age specifically, however, members who join through MSU can receive a discounted student membership,” Zipcar’s Public Relations Specialist CJ Himberg said.
